Top 5 SQL IDEs for Efficient Database Management in 2025

In the realm of database management, Integrated Development Environments (IDEs) are essential for streamlining operations, enhancing productivity, and facilitating efficient querying. This article explores the Top 5 SQL IDEs for 2025, emphasizing their key features, strengths, and how they contribute to improved database management. Special attention is given to Chat2DB, a leading SQL IDE that incorporates advanced AI capabilities, significantly enhancing the overall database management experience. By understanding these tools, developers and database administrators can make informed decisions that best suit their needs.
The Importance of SQL IDEs in Modern Database Management
SQL IDEs are vital tools that significantly enhance the interaction between developers, database administrators, and databases. They provide a user-friendly interface for writing, executing, and optimizing SQL queries, simplifying the complex tasks involved in database management. The evolution of SQL IDEs has introduced several advanced features that streamline database operations, making them indispensable in today's data-driven world.
Key features of an excellent SQL IDE include:
- Code Completion: Minimizes errors by suggesting SQL commands, making it easier for developers to write queries efficiently.
- Syntax Highlighting: Improves readability by visually distinguishing different components of SQL code, enhancing understanding and reducing mistakes.
- Database Connection Management: Allows users to connect to multiple databases seamlessly, enabling easier management of diverse data sources.
Overall, SQL IDEs play a critical role in increasing productivity, reducing errors, and facilitating better collaboration among team members.
Key Features to Look for in an SQL IDE
When selecting an SQL IDE, several features should be considered to ensure optimal efficiency in database management:
-
User-Friendly Interface: A clean and intuitive interface is crucial for reducing the learning curve and enhancing productivity. Developers should navigate the IDE with ease, focusing on writing and optimizing SQL queries.
-
Advanced Code Editing Tools: Features like IntelliSense and auto-completion significantly reduce coding errors, allowing developers to write complex queries with confidence.
-
Database Visualization Tools: These tools simplify the understanding of complex data structures, making it easier to visualize relationships between tables and entities.
-
Integration with Version Control Systems: This feature is important for collaborative projects, allowing multiple developers to work on the same database without conflicts.
-
Cross-Platform Compatibility: An IDE that works across various operating systems (Windows, macOS, Linux) ensures flexibility and convenience for developers working in different environments.
Chat2DB: A Comprehensive SQL IDE for 2023
Chat2DB (opens in a new tab) is an innovative SQL IDE designed to enhance database management through its AI-powered features. It stands out in the market due to its unique capabilities that cater to both novice and experienced developers.
Unique Features of Chat2DB:
- AI-Powered Query Suggestions: By analyzing user behavior and previous queries, Chat2DB offers tailored query suggestions, helping developers write efficient SQL commands swiftly. For example, if a user frequently queries a customer database, Chat2DB will suggest relevant queries based on that history.
SELECT * FROM customers WHERE last_name LIKE 'Smit%';
- Natural Language Processing: Users can perform database operations using natural language queries, making the tool accessible to those who may not be familiar with SQL syntax. For instance, a user can simply ask, "Show me all orders from last month," and Chat2DB will convert it into the appropriate SQL command.
SELECT * FROM orders WHERE order_date >= DATE_SUB(CURDATE(), INTERVAL 1 MONTH);
-
Intuitive Interface: The user-friendly design of Chat2DB simplifies database operations, allowing users to focus on data analysis rather than struggling with complex interfaces.
-
Support for Multiple Database Engines: Chat2DB is compatible with over 24 databases, making it a versatile choice for various development environments.
-
Built-in Security Features: The IDE ensures that all database interactions are secure, protecting sensitive information from unauthorized access.
With its advanced AI functionalities, Chat2DB significantly boosts productivity and streamlines database management tasks, making it a preferred choice for many developers.
Comparing Top SQL IDEs: A Detailed Analysis
In this section, we will conduct a comparative analysis of several leading SQL IDEs, including Chat2DB, SQL Developer, DBeaver, HeidiSQL, and DataGrip. This comparison will focus on their unique features, strengths, and limitations.
Feature | Chat2DB | SQL Developer | DBeaver | HeidiSQL | DataGrip |
---|---|---|---|---|---|
AI Features | Yes, AI-powered suggestions | No | Limited | No | No |
User Interface | Intuitive and user-friendly | Moderate | Complex | Simple | Professional |
Cross-Platform | Yes | Limited (Windows only) | Yes | Yes | Yes |
Database Support | 24+ databases | Oracle only | 80+ databases | MySQL, MariaDB, SQL Server | 20+ databases |
Security Features | Built-in security measures | Basic | Basic | Basic | Advanced |
Analysis of Each IDE:
-
Chat2DB: With its AI features and user-friendly interface, Chat2DB significantly enhances productivity. It is ideal for teams working with multiple databases and looking for efficient management tools.
-
SQL Developer: Primarily designed for Oracle databases, it lacks AI functionalities but is a solid choice for those focused solely on Oracle environments.
-
DBeaver: Known for its extensive database support, DBeaver offers a robust set of features but can be overwhelming due to its complex interface.
-
HeidiSQL: A lightweight option, HeidiSQL is simple and effective for MySQL and SQL Server users but lacks the advanced features found in other IDEs.
-
DataGrip: A professional-grade tool with advanced features, DataGrip excels in database management but does not offer the AI capabilities present in Chat2DB.
In conclusion, while each SQL IDE has its strengths, Chat2DB's AI-driven features and ease of use make it a standout choice for 2023.
Enhancing Developer Productivity with SQL IDEs
Maximizing developer productivity is essential for successful database management. SQL IDEs offer various strategies to enhance efficiency, including:
Automation
Automation features significantly reduce repetitive tasks, allowing developers to focus on more complex queries and data analysis. For example, Chat2DB automates query suggestions and optimizations, making it easier to write efficient SQL commands.
Customizable Interfaces
Customizable interfaces and keyboard shortcuts can tailor the development environment to individual preferences. This personalization can lead to quicker navigation and reduced time spent on routine tasks.
Real-Time Collaboration
Many IDEs support real-time collaboration, enabling teams to work together seamlessly. This feature is crucial for project management, ensuring that all team members are on the same page.
Continuous Updates
Regular updates and support from the IDE provider ensure that users have access to the latest features and security enhancements. Chat2DB continuously evolves, incorporating user feedback to improve its functionalities.
Optimizing IDE Settings
Fine-tuning SQL IDE settings can lead to faster and more efficient database management. Developers should explore various configurations to find the optimal setup for their workflow.
The Future of SQL IDEs: Trends and Innovations
The landscape of SQL IDEs is continually evolving, with several emerging trends shaping the future of database management:
AI and Machine Learning
The integration of AI and machine learning is revolutionizing how developers interact with databases. Tools like Chat2DB leverage these technologies to enhance query optimization and error detection, making database management more intuitive.
Cloud-Based IDEs
Cloud-based SQL IDEs are gaining popularity due to their remote accessibility and collaboration features. These platforms allow developers to work from anywhere, facilitating global teamwork.
Enhanced Security Features
As data breaches become more common, the focus on security features in SQL IDEs is increasing. IDEs must provide robust security measures to protect sensitive data and ensure safe interactions within the database.
Augmented and Virtual Reality
The potential for augmented reality (AR) and virtual reality (VR) in visualizing complex data environments is an exciting frontier. These technologies could provide immersive experiences that simplify data analysis and enhance understanding.
Open-Source Contributions
Open-source contributions continue to drive innovation and feature enhancements in SQL IDEs, fostering a community-driven approach to development.
In summary, SQL IDEs are evolving to meet the demands of modern database management, and tools like Chat2DB are at the forefront of this innovation.
Further Learning and Utilizing Chat2DB
As you explore the world of SQL IDEs, consider leveraging Chat2DB (opens in a new tab) for your database management needs. Its advanced AI features and user-friendly interface make it a powerful tool for developers and database administrators alike. By adopting Chat2DB, you can enhance your productivity and streamline your database operations.
FAQ
-
What is an SQL IDE? An SQL IDE is an Integrated Development Environment that provides tools and features to assist developers and database administrators in managing databases and writing SQL queries efficiently.
-
What are the benefits of using Chat2DB? Chat2DB offers AI-powered query suggestions, natural language processing capabilities, and support for multiple database engines, making it a versatile and efficient choice for database management.
-
Can I use Chat2DB on different operating systems? Yes, Chat2DB is compatible with Windows, macOS, and Linux, providing flexibility for developers working in diverse environments.
-
How does automation in SQL IDEs improve productivity? Automation features reduce repetitive tasks, allowing developers to focus on more complex queries and data analysis, ultimately enhancing overall productivity.
-
What are the key trends in SQL IDE development? Key trends include the integration of AI and machine learning, the rise of cloud-based IDEs, enhanced security features, and the potential for AR and VR in data visualization.
Get Started with Chat2DB Pro
If you're looking for an intuitive, powerful, and AI-driven database management tool, give Chat2DB a try! Whether you're a database administrator, developer, or data analyst, Chat2DB simplifies your work with the power of AI.
Enjoy a 30-day free trial of Chat2DB Pro. Experience all the premium features without any commitment, and see how Chat2DB can revolutionize the way you manage and interact with your databases.
👉 Start your free trial today (opens in a new tab) and take your database operations to the next level!